Transaction 31f3aae7f2f685840343643e8853dc830884fc951a69ceb2b68b5b659279a655
1 Input
1 Output
-
31f3aae7f2f685840343643e8853dc830884fc951a69ceb2b68b5b659279a655:0
- value
- 860162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0775e9ba74121357748d3fda186c256ec11af7c4 OP_EQUAL
- address
- 32NTudEXDbmsSk9JRW68ZELoGUMgViivMx